출근길에 - On the way to work.
Phrase:
출근길에 병원에 들렀다가 조금늦게 하겠습니다.

I will be a bit late to work as i will drop by the hospital
많이 안좋나 보군요. 일보고 천천히 들어오세요.
You must be really unwell, take your time
Vocabulary:
출근 = work
길 = road
병원 = hospital
조금 = little
늦게 = late
많이 = a lot
안좋나 = not well
보군요 = see (보다)
일 = work
보고 = see (보다)
천천히 = Slowly
들렀다가 = stopped by
하겠습니다 = I will
들어오세요 = come in
출근길에 = On the way to work

Email, 이메일
이 메일로 연락하시면 됩니다
You can contact me by email
이메일 주소 좀 알락 주십시오
Please tell me your email address
명함에 제 이메일 주소가 나와 있습니다
My email address is on my business card
이주소는 업무용 이메일 주소입니다
This is my Business email address

Business Korean: Greetings 1
1. Going to work
A: 안녕하세요?
B: 네, 좋은 아침입니다.
A: How are you?
B: Yes, good morning.
Monday Morning is great because you can ask about the persons weekend, the simplest way is...
A: 안녕하세요?
B: 네, 안녕하십니까? 주말 잘 보내셨어요?
A: How are you?
B: Yes, How are you? Have a good weekend, did you?
